Sodium Butyl Xanthate


INQUIRY
Description

Structural FormulaCH3CH2CH2CH2OCSSNa

Properties: Light yellow powder, with bad smell, soluble in water and alcohol, can mix with a variety of metal ions and insoluble compounds.

Purpose: Sodium butyl xanthate is a kind of flotation reagent with strong collecting ability, which is widely used in the mixed flotation of various non-ferrous sulfide ores. It is especially suitable for flotation of chalcopyrite, sphalerite and pyrite. Under specific conditions, it can be used to preferentially flotation copper sulfide from pyrite, and can also effectively capture and activate sphalerite with copper sulfate.

Specification: Conform to YS / T269-2008 standard.

Packing: Open steel drum lined with plastic bag or reformed small steel drum, net weight of each drum is 120KG; woven bag, net weight of each bag is 25 or 40KG; granular xanthate is packed in wooden case with enlarged bag, net weight of each box is 800KG.

Storage and Transportation: The products should be placed in a cool and ventilated place to prevent moisture, fire and sun exposure.
